About the role

As a laundry assistant you will:

  • Ensure all linen and clothing are washed at the correct temperatures in line with infection control guidelines.

  • Dry, fold, and distribute laundry correctly to designated cupboards or individual residents’ rooms.

  • Maintain a clean, safe, and well-organised laundry area at all times.

  • Report any faulty equipment or maintenance issues to the Registered Manager or Nurse in Charge.

  • Follow all Health & Safety regulations, including COSHH guidelines, to ensure a safe working environment.
